I want to install flush mount caps on my '05 Softail. I don't want the left side to be a gas gauge, my gas gauge has been broken since last spring anyways. Can I just get 2 plain flush mount gas caps for the right side and install one on the left or is there something I'm missing for that left side?
If I recall correctly, a flush gas fill cap will be too small to fill the hole left by removing your gas gauge. My gas gauge never worked, so I got rid of mine. I cut out a piece of sheet metal and welded it in where the gas gauge went. I was getting ready to paint my tank at the time anyway, so a little extra body work didn't matter.
You might check out Kuryakyn's set of flush mounts. The right side is the gas cap, left side is matching gas gauge and charging monitor lights. I'm running that set and really like the look. Personal opinion.

If you install the flush set the left side will just look like a cap if it is not hooked up (no led lights). Even if you could get two gas caps it wouldn't work on the left side because there is nothing to screw it into.
